Tour Overview

Mount Meru, rising to 4,566m (14,980ft), is Tanzania’s second-highest peak and a spectacular trekking destination located inside Arusha National Park. Often considered Kilimanjaro’s “little brother,” Meru offers a shorter but equally rewarding climb, with dramatic volcanic scenery, rich wildlife encounters, and panoramic views of Kilimanjaro itself.

Unlike Kilimanjaro, the trek begins with a walking safari, where giraffes, buffalo, antelopes, and monkeys roam freely along the trail. The climb then ascends through lush rainforest, heathland, and alpine desert, culminating in a sunrise summit at Socialist Peak. The 4-day itinerary includes an extra acclimatization day at Saddle Hut, making it the most balanced option for trekkers who want both comfort and success.

This trek is ideal for adventurers seeking a moderate challenge, diverse landscapes, and unforgettable views, all within a shorter timeframe than Kilimanjaro.

Tour Itinerary

Day 1: Momella Gate → Miriakamba Hut (2,500m)
Trekking distance: ~10 km (5–7 hours)
Highlights: Begin with a walking safari through Arusha National Park. Spot giraffes, buffalo, zebras, and monkeys along the trail. The path ascends steadily through montane forest, alive with birdlife and waterfalls. Overnight at Miriakamba Hut.
Day 2: Miriakamba Hut → Saddle Hut (3,570m)
Trekking distance: ~8 km (4–6 hours)
Highlights: Steeper climb through lush forest and into heathland. Enjoy spectacular views of the Meru Crater and Ash Cone. Arrive at Saddle Hut, located below Little Meru. Optional afternoon hike to Little Meru (3,820m) for acclimatization and sunset views.
Day 3: Saddle Hut → Socialist Peak (4,566m) → Return to Saddle Hut
Trekking distance: ~14 km (10–12 hours)
Highlights: Begin summit push around midnight. Trek steeply to Rhino Point (3,800m) and Cobra Point (4,350m), then continue to Socialist Peak (4,566m). Witness a breathtaking sunrise over Kilimanjaro and the Great Rift Valley. Descend back to Saddle Hut for rest.
Day 4: Saddle Hut → Momella Gate
Trekking distance: ~14 km (4–6 hours)
Highlights: A steady descent through forest and savanna. Spot wildlife along the way and reflect on your incredible journey. At Momella Gate, receive your climbing certificate before returning to Arusha.
